Position Summary
The WashU Med Neurofibromatosis (NF) Center is seeking a PRN Physical Therapist to assist the NF Center Coordinator during weekend therapy events for individuals with a diagnosis of Neurofibromatosis Type 1 (NF1). Events are primarily held once a month on Saturdays, in addition to a summer camp for one week in the month of August. Some additional preparation will be needed for each event.The Physical Therapist will work closely with the NF Center Coordinator, who is also a licensed Occupational Therapist.
Job Description
Primary Duties & Responsibilities:
- Attend all therapy events, which may include weekends.
- Complete any at home preparation leading up to each event.
- Provide reasonable modifications to all therapy activities.
- Assist individuals during events with the least amount of support needed.
- Collaborate with occupational therapist on program development.
- Brainstorm new event ideas.
